Max Width
Go to question details page

Given an array of words and a max_width parameter, write a function justify to format the text such that each line has exactly max_width characters. Pad extra spaces ’ ‘ when necessary so that each line has exactly max_width characters.

Extra spaces between words should be distributed as evenly as possible. If the number of spaces on a line does not divide evenly between words, place excess spaces on the right-hand side of each line.

Note: You may assume that there is no word in words that is longer than max_width.

Example:

Input:

words = ["This", "is", "an", "example", "of", "text", "justification."]
max_width = 16

def justify(words, max_width): ->
[
   "This    is    an",
   "example  of text",
   "justification.  "
]
